(5-hydroxyindol-3-yl)acetic acid : A member of the class of indole-3-acetic acids that is indole-3-acetic acid substituted by a hydroxy group at C-5.
Stomach Ulcer: Ulceration of the GASTRIC MUCOSA due to contact with GASTRIC JUICE. It is often associated with HELICOBACTER PYLORI infection or consumption of nonsteroidal anti-inflammatory drugs (NSAIDS).
